Need a new LinkedIn profile picture, acting headshots or even portraits for web and social media sites? Save time and money by using Try it on AI for your perfect AI Headshot. Pay $17 for 100 AI Images. Then submit your photos and choose portrait styles. Please follow the instructions carefully to get the best results. We do not offer any refunds. You'll receive a success email in 24 hours. You'll get 100 images so you can pick out a few of the best. If you'd like to add a human touch to your portrait, we offer $10/portrait for human editing. You will receive 100 AI headshots 640px by 640px within 24 hours after you submit 10+ photos. Some customers receive them in a matter of hours. However, this depends on how many portraits our system creates on any given day. AI isn't always perfect, and some glitches can make you laugh. We hope that by providing you with a huge collection of images and styles, you will find some that you like.
